Kotlin from Scratch - Islam, Faisal; - Prospero Internet Bookshop

Kotlin from Scratch: A Project-Based Introduction for the Intrepid Programmer
 
Product details:

ISBN13:9781718503526
ISBN10:17185035211
Binding:Paperback
No. of pages:432 pages
Size:235x178 mm
Language:English
695
Category:

Kotlin from Scratch

A Project-Based Introduction for the Intrepid Programmer
 
Publisher: No Starch Press
Date of Publication:
 
Normal price:

Publisher's listprice:
GBP 56.99
Estimated price in HUF:
29 919 HUF (28 495 HUF + 5% VAT)
Why estimated?
 
Your price:

26 030 (24 791 HUF + 5% VAT )
discount is: 13% (approx 3 889 HUF off)
The discount is only available for 'Alert of Favourite Topics' newsletter recipients.
Click here to subscribe.
 
Availability:

Estimated delivery time: In stock at the publisher, but not at Prospero's office. Delivery time approx. 3-5 weeks.
Not in stock at Prospero.
Can't you provide more accurate information?
 
  Piece(s)

 
Long description:
Kotlin is a programming language that combines the best features of Python and Java into a single, easy-to-use language that's rapidly growing. Though Kotlin is primarily known for Android app development, this book establishes its broader credentials for general-purpose coding - complete with geeky, hands-on projects that will take you from total beginner to proficient Kotlin developer. After learning the basics of the language and integrating the JavaFX library to generate graphics and data visualizations, you'll apply your knowledge to over 30 math, science, and algorithmic challenges of increasing complexity. You'll model the motion of a pendulum, simulate the orbits of a binary star system, render enchanting fractals like the Mandelbrot set, implement ant colony optimization and other nature-inspired algorithms, and much more. Beyond the specifics of the Kotlin language, the book's many projects will teach you how to think methodically and use code to solve problems. You'll also learn about generally applicable computer science topics such as randomness, recursion, sorting and searching, genetic algorithms, and optimization.